“节点机”(Node Machine)通常指在分布式系统、计算机网络或集群计算中作为独立单元运行的设备或服务器。具体含义取决于应用场景,以下是不同领域中的常见解释:# Y: p( I) x7 \8 t* x8 j
### 1. **计算机网络**- p6 H6 e, v7 c. _; G8 `8 A C G; T5 z
- **定义**:网络中的一个节点可以是路由器、交换机、服务器或终端设备(如电脑、手机),负责数据转发、存储或处理。$ @/ p' o( U' L% v6 d
- **作用**:维护网络通信,确保数据传输的可靠性。, I& K# q4 Z( H/ I3 }# d3 r
### 2. **区块链与分布式账本**& @- U7 I. `, R
- **定义**:运行区块链协议(如比特币、以太坊)的计算机,参与验证交易、存储账本。6 E, m$ f- k. \! v$ T# q7 m6 t
- **类型**:
% z# b$ _5 h6 l i6 v- **全节点**:存储完整账本,验证所有交易。
! L! ~* `/ I; C- **矿工节点**:通过算力竞争生成新区块(如比特币挖矿)。0 c9 a0 m. O9 ?' Y
- **轻节点**:依赖全节点获取部分数据,节省资源。( h* I1 k% _2 p4 i6 {$ c3 N
### 3. **高性能计算(HPC)与集群**
# m% W$ e6 r" C6 j- **定义**:集群中的单个计算单元,多个节点通过高速网络互联,协同完成大规模计算任务。
% e" d; Y- e" F- y& H- **组成**:
5 f. t0 R% _" Z" ~7 o1 B- **计算节点**:执行密集型计算。# C, @, B0 a6 B7 z) P& ?
- **存储节点**:提供分布式存储。
) g4 i5 W0 s: }5 i. Z$ w: j- **管理节点**:调度任务与资源。* ^1 y& d7 w- V9 H
### 4. **云计算与微服务**: f& a* ?1 q3 c2 q+ I
- **定义**:在云平台或容器化架构(如Kubernetes)中,节点是运行服务实例的虚拟机或物理机。" n5 P4 r- m L: D9 X
- **作用**:托管容器、处理请求,支持弹性扩缩容。
, r" B; |% B# ]% ?4 O9 [### 5. **物联网(IoT)**) @' i+ O% W1 H2 ^. y; G3 R0 r8 w
- **定义**:终端设备(如传感器、智能设备)作为边缘节点,负责数据采集和初步处理。
$ E2 ^" R) a2 `+ t---
v8 a! o3 N: o; c+ R### **典型应用场景**
+ j7 L8 m/ G! P7 i* S4 ]4 n7 E- **区块链**:运行比特币全节点需高存储(400GB+)和稳定网络。0 C) a# b( t4 Q& S* H
- **HPC集群**:科研机构使用数千节点模拟气候、基因分析。
! B0 e) D, _, l$ y8 x- **CDN网络**:全球分布的节点缓存内容,加速用户访问。/ y. M& ?/ g& o$ t: }
---. {2 E4 b# o' F+ g3 h
### **选择节点机的关键因素**
& L; c$ Z; @* k) \9 e! Z1. **硬件配置**:CPU/GPU性能、内存、存储(SSD/HDD)。
2 F! R& C& m9 Z4 ` N) t2. **网络**:带宽、延迟(尤其对区块链和HPC)。# W9 y8 {6 J2 o& A* C$ z
3. **软件支持**:操作系统、协议兼容性(如Kubernetes、区块链客户端)。
9 v( n1 H; j/ p4. **成本**:电费、硬件采购、维护成本(如矿机需考虑能耗比)。
" b+ g5 D7 l$ ~9 f如果需要更具体的建议(如搭建区块链节点或配置HPC集群),可进一步说明场景!
0 |+ { _* S# D/ [) e8 |. c#吧友把DeepSeek玩出花# q: @9 G8 V8 w
确实不错
1 A }! o, j3 g3 {$ \6 B
1 Z! Q: M! S4 G0 y* |5 }
$ p9 m6 ]3 j5 R4 w! ]
C G) L, x' L: h! B* S3 v) ^, e
|